Transaction 359e5fb315743664898b7a98165638523a46bfc35484f7fe6a49592608f88aac
1 Input
1 Output
-
359e5fb315743664898b7a98165638523a46bfc35484f7fe6a49592608f88aac:0
- value
- 1317754
- script pubkey
- OP_0 OP_PUSHBYTES_20 98afdde522a7fc06c55f714b24751327ef3a2da6
- address
- bc1qnzhamefz5l7qd32lw99jgagnylhn5tdxcjn9gx